Agriedo Hub
Agriedo Hub is a Tanzanian business development organisation headquartered in Iringa. Co-founded by Hadija Jabiri, Agriedo brings over 15 years of hands-on experience in building and scaling agri-businesses across Tanzania.
The organisation works across the agricultural value chain to support youth- and women-led enterprises, combining practical entrepreneurship support with strong market linkages. Under the leadership of Hadija Jabiri — an established agribusiness entrepreneur and founder of GBRI Business Solutions (EatFresh.co.tz) — Agriedo has developed a solid track record in designing inclusive, market-driven solutions rooted in local realities. Hadija and Agriedo are co-founders of Rootical Tanzania.

Fresh Ventures Studio
Fresh builds new companies that accelerate a circular and regenerative food system. Fresh launched in 2021 to work alongside founders to address the world’s most pressing problems through scalable impact-ventures. Initially their focus is on the European food system, with a current pipeline of 13 systemic ventures.
Taking the initiative to develop Rootical, Hannes joined Fresh Ventures’ structure to jointly implement a context-specific startup studio in Tanzania.

Liechtenstein Development Service
The Liechtenstein Development Service (LED) is the official bilateral development cooperation organisation of the Principality of Liechtenstein.
Liechtenstein’s bilateral development cooperation is guided by four principles. Leave no one behind, gender equality, cultural diversity and ecological sustainability. This makes the food systems work with a focus on Agroecology critical and central to their work. Hence, LED is a core partner for Rootical’s launch in Tanzania.
